Today Rogers has turned on LTE in 18 new markets through out Canada. With the addition of these markets, Rogers has just about met their goal of covering 60% of Canadians by the end of 2012. It’s always nice to see carriers ahead of schedule on updates like LTE. So here are the lucky markets in Canada that get to experience that blazing fast LTE speeds:
- British Columbia: Victoria, Abbotsford, Kelowna
- Alberta: Edmonton
- Saskatchewan: Saskatoon and Regina
- Ontario: St. Catharines/Niagara, Oshawa/Pickering/Ajax, Windsor, Sudbury, Kingston, Oakville, Burlington, Hamilton, London, Kitchener, Waterloo, Cambridge and Barrie
- Quebec: Quebec, Sherbrooke and Trois-Rivieres
Rogers also promised over the summer that we would see 28 cities with LTE coverage the year is out. So we should be getting a few more markets and expansions in the next couple of months.
